You will need to include Prism before including Prism Live.You can either manually include prism-live.css yourself, and import prism-live.js and any language components,and then call PrismLive.registerLanguage(id, lang)or you can use the built-in dynamic loader and just include prism-live.mjs with a load parameterabout which components to include.
You will need to include Prism before including Prism Live.You can either manually include prism-live.css, prism-live.js and any language components,or you can use the built-in dynamic loader and just include prism-live.js with a load parameterabout which components to include.
If the primary use case is editing, it makes sense to intialize from a ,so that the code is still editable, even if the JavaScript fails to load.Just include a in your HTML.It will automatically be initialized, with the contents of the textarea as the code.
If the primary use case is displaying code, it makes sense to initialize from a , same as the one you'd write for using Prism.Just use a class of prism-live on it, and Prism Live will take care of the rest.
PRISM Live is a useful tool for anyone who's looking for a way to enhance their pre-recorded videos and live streams on social networks. This app brings you tons of filters, stickers and other camera effects to enhance your productions and make them look amazing.
The minimalist and intelligent design in PRISM Live makes it so that practically anyone can enjoy using its features from the very first moment regardless of previous experience with similar apps. From the main menu, you can select if you want to apply the effects to pre-recorded videos, photos, or live streams. To apply any of these effects, you just have to tap on the one you like and it'll appear on the screen automatically.

First opened its door in March 2012, Prism Live Hall has become one of the OGs of rock clubs in Hongdae. Renovated with state-of-the-art sound system and a better stage-to-crowd structure last October, Prism Hall is capable of hosting any kind of live events.
When I lived in Japan, I once recorded arcade videos of PriPara and PriChan using unofficial USB recording devices at some arcades. This is no longer available as both arcade games were discontinued in February 2022. PriMagi was also discontinued as of March 2023. Some Prism Stone shops used to still run older Pretty Series games, but as of now PriPara was re-discontinued in March 2024 and Pretty Rhythm was re-discontinued in April 2024. If you visit Japan, you will be able to play the newest Pretty Series games, Himitsu no AiPri and AiPri Verse, at arcades nationwide!

Live Tonite is a live album recorded by Canadian rock band Prism in 1978 at Detroit's Royal Oak Music Theater. The album features songs from Prism's first two studio albums "Prism" and "See Forever Eyes". The album was originally released on a special blue vinyl LP as well as black vinyl LP.
PRISM Live Studio is a live streaming software developed by NAVER Corp. It is a tool that enables content creators to easily broadcast live streams on various platforms. The software offers a multitude of features including customizable layouts, overlays, and real-time video effects.
With PRISM Live Studio, users can create multiple scenes with different layouts, add text and image overlays, and switch seamlessly between scenes during their live streams. Users can also apply real-time video effects such as filters and chroma key to add visual impact to their streams.
The software offers support for popular streaming platforms such as YouTube Live, Twitch, Facebook Live, and more. Additionally, the software provides an easy way to perform multi-camera productions by connecting multiple cameras to the computer via USB or HDMI.
